Suma numerelor de forma a4b cu produsul cifrelor 24 este egala cu
AnnZ [12381]

Answer:

The correct response is: b)

Step-by-step explanation:

a4b=24, where a × 4 × b = 24 implies a × b = 6

The pairs of numbers with a product of 6 include: {1,6} and {2,3}

In base 10, a4b translates to 100a + 40 + b

Calculating gives us:

100×1+40+6=146

100×6+40+1=641

100×2+40+3=243

100×3+40+2=342

Summing these results yields: 146 + 641 + 243 + 342 = 1372

The correct answer is: b)

Which statements are true regarding undefinable terms in geometry? Select TWO options
PIT_PIT [12445]

Answer:

3) A line has one dimension, length. (True)

5) A plane is made up of an infinite collection of lines. (True)

Explanation:

Geometry has three undefined terms:

a) point

b) line

c) plane

Examining the given statements:

1) A point described as (x, y) has two dimensions — this is incorrect because a point has no dimensions.

2) A plane has clear start and end points — this is false as a plane extends infinitely without boundaries.

3) A line has exactly one dimension, which is its length. (True)

4) A point consists of countless lines — this is false; actually, a line consists of infinite points.

5) A plane consists of an unending set of lines. (True)
